About Holme Green
Holme Green is a small village located in North Yorkshire, England, within the postcode area YO23. The village is primarily residential, with a mix of traditional and modern homes. Surrounding the area are fields and woodlands, offering opportunities for walking and enjoying nature. The village has a close-knit community feel, with local amenities that cater to residents. Transport links are accessible, with nearby roads connecting Holme Green to larger towns and cities in the region. The village is also in proximity to the River Ouse, which provides a scenic backdrop for outdoor activities. Local schools and services are available, making it a suitable place for families. Overall, Holme Green offers a peaceful lifestyle while remaining connected to the broader North Yorkshire area.
School Ratings in Holme Green
Holme Green is served by 17 schools. Knavesmire Primary School is rated Outstanding by Ofsted. A further 6 schools hold a Good rating.
House Prices in Holme Green
Property prices average £374K across the area, and terraced houses are the most common property type, typically selling for £342K.
Crime and Anti-Social Behaviour in Holme Green
Local crime rates sit higher than national averages. Anti-social behaviour accounts for the highest share in Holme Green, with 32 incidents logged in March 2026.
Deprivation and Employment in Holme Green
Holme Green falls within the least deprived areas nationally, based on the 2025 Index of Multiple Deprivation. The area benefits from strong employment, with few residents involuntarily out of work. Income levels across the area tend to be higher than the national average.
